WebFeb 18, 2024 · Corrections. Corrections refers to the supervision of persons arrested for, convicted of, or sentenced for criminal offenses. Correctional populations fall into two general categories: institutional corrections and community corrections. Corrections data, with a few exceptions, covers adult agencies or facilities and adult offenders. WebOffender Reentry/Transition. Reentry refers to the transition of offenders from prisons or jails back into the community. According to the U.S. Department of Justice, Office of Justice Programs 641,100 people were released from state and federal prisons in 2015. WebBritannica Dictionary definition of JAIL. : a place where people are kept when they have been arrested and are being punished for a crime. [count] He was locked up in the county jail. [noncount] He was arrested and sent/sentenced to jail. He went to jail for his crimes. He just got out of jail a few weeks ago. He was kept in jail overnight.
